Restraining Competition in Taiwan
Dell’s Taiwan-based subsidiary was fined NT$2 million (US$65,600) by Taiwan’s Fair Trade Commission for taking action to restrain competition. According to media accounts, Dell Taiwan violated fair trade rules pertaining to causing another enterprise to discontinue supply, purchase or other business transactions with a particular enterprise for the purpose of injuring that enterprise. In 2013, Dell Taiwan asked a local distributor of SonicWALL, an anti-virus program developed by Dell, not to supply the product to the southern region branch of Chunghwa Telecom Company.
